Sealey Sand Blasting Cabinet Double Access
Heavy-duty steel cabinets with toughened glass viewing screen and integral low voltage illumination. Double side doors on Model No. SB974 provide easy-access for bulkier items. Includes dust extraction port. Supplied with heavy gauntlets, sand blasting gun and four ceramic nozzles. Suitable for glass beads, silicone carbide, aluminium oxide and shot blasting grit only. Features & Benefits: • Heavy-duty steel cabinet and doors, toughened glass viewing screen and integral low voltage illumination. • Two side doors provide easy-access for bulkier items. • Ø64mm Dust extraction port. • Heavy gauntlets provide hand protection and cabinet is supplied with sand blasting gun and four ceramic nozzles. • Suitable for glass beads, silicone carbide, aluminium oxide and shot blasting grit only. • Overall Size (W x D x H): 960 x 720 x 1500mm. • Model No. SB974 Specifications: Model No SB974 Air Consumption: 18-39cfm Brand: Sealey Door Size: Door Width: 580mm, Min./Max. Height: 320/495mm Doors: 2 Extraction Port Diameter: Ø64mm Inlet Size: 1/4''BSP Nett Weight: 64kg Operating Pressure: 60-125psi Optional Accessories: n/a Overall Dimensions (W x D x H): 960 x 720 x 1500mm Viewing Area: 580 x 270mm Working Aperture: n/a

Sealey SB970 Double Access Sand Blasting Cabinet
Heavy-duty steel cabinet with toughened glass viewing screen and integral low voltage illumination. Two large side doors provide easy-access for bulkier items. Includes Ø34mm dust extraction port for a clear view. Heavy gauntlets provide hand protection and cabinet is supplied with sand blasting gun with three spare ceramic nozzles. Suitable for glass beads, silica sand, aluminium oxide and other proprietary brands of blasting media. Includes pack of 10 screen covers. Features & Benefits: • Heavy-duty steel cabinet with toughened glass viewing screen and integral low voltage illumination. • Two large side doors provide easy-access for bulkier items and includes Ø34mm dust extraction port for a clear view. • Heavy gauntlets provide hand protection and cabinet is supplied with sand blasting gun with three spare ceramic nozzles. • Includes pack of 10 screen covers. • Overall Size (W x D x H): 695 x 580 x 625mm. • Model No. SB970 Specifications: Model No SB970 Air Consumption: 10cfm Brand: Sealey Door Size: Door Width: 525mm, Min./Max. Height: 240/430mm Doors: 2 Extraction Port Diameter: Ø34mm Inlet Size: 1/4"BSP Nett Weight: 24.0kg Operating Pressure: 60-125psi Optional Accessories: n/a Overall Dimensions (W x D x H): 695 x 580 x 625mm Viewing Area: 485 x 275mm Working Aperture: n/a

How can one carry out a kitchen renovation in a room without access to water and sewage?
Carrying out a kitchen renovation in a room without access to water and sewage can be challenging, but it is possible with some strategic planning. One option is to set up a temporary kitchen in another area of the house that does have access to water and sewage. This temporary kitchen can include essentials like a microwave, toaster oven, and portable cooktop. Another option is to use disposable plates, utensils, and cups to minimize the need for washing dishes. Additionally, planning the renovation in stages and coordinating with a professional to ensure the project is completed efficiently can help minimize the inconvenience of not having access to water and sewage during the renovation.

How do I access my access point?
To access your access point, you will need to connect to the same network that the access point is on. Once connected, open a web browser and enter the IP address of the access point in the address bar. You may need to enter a username and password to log in to the access point's settings. From there, you can configure and manage the access point as needed.

What are kitchen cabinet feet?
Kitchen cabinet feet are decorative or functional elements that are added to the bottom of kitchen cabinets. They can be used to elevate the cabinets off the ground, providing a more open and airy feel to the kitchen. They can also serve as decorative accents, adding a touch of style to the cabinets. Additionally, cabinet feet can help protect the bottom of the cabinets from moisture and damage.

Why is access denied despite having admin access?
Access may be denied despite having admin access due to various reasons such as incorrect permissions, security restrictions, or system errors. It is possible that the admin access does not have the necessary permissions to access the specific resource or perform the desired action. Additionally, there may be security measures in place that restrict certain admin privileges to prevent unauthorized access or changes. It is also possible that there could be a technical issue or error preventing the admin access from being recognized or utilized properly. Troubleshooting and reviewing the specific access controls and permissions in place can help identify and resolve the issue.
